About Altus Schools Audeo

As a close-knit multi-level school in San Diego, California, Altus Schools Audeo hosts 450 students from grades K through 12, one of the schools within Altus Schools Audeo District. Enrollment runs roughly 25% below the state mean of about 602.

Operationally, Altus Schools Audeo answers to Altus Schools Audeo District, which sets policy, hires staff, and reports enrollment to the state.

For racial and ethnic makeup, Altus Schools Audeo reports that the largest single group is Hispanic at 52%, but no single group is in the majority; the rest looks like 30% White, 7% multiracial, 6% Black, 3% Asian. The wider county runs roughly 35% Hispanic, putting the school's mix considerably more Hispanic than the area baseline.

In terms of school funding signals, On paper, Altus Schools Audeo has 15 full-time-equivalent teachers, translating to a class-load average of around 30.7:1.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 18.6:1, putting Altus Schools Audeo higher than the state norm the norm. Around 64% of the student body qualifies for free or reduced-price meals, a number frequently used as a low-income enrollment indicator. That share is noticeably above San Diego County's rate of about 54%.

In the broader community, San Diego County reports that median household income runs about $106,268, 43%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 7%. Across San Diego County's 766 public schools (combined enrollment of about 467,437 students), Altus Schools Audeo is one campus in the mix.

The closest other public school is Juarez Elementary, roughly 1.0 miles away. Counting just inside five miles, 8 other public schools cluster around Altus Schools Audeo.

The school occupies a downtown site. As a public charter, Altus Schools Audeo runs on public funding but with greater curricular and operational autonomy than a typical district school.
